Career

Author and illustrator. Exhibitions: Work exhibited at Dunedin Public Arts Gallery, 1974; Fruitmarket, Edinburgh, Scotland; Atlantis Gallery, London, Mitre Gallery, Chichester, England; Hanover Gallery, Liverpool, England; Brighton Museum and Art Gallery, Brighton, England; and in public and private collections in Australasia, Europe, and the United States.

Awards, Honors

Esther Glen Award (with wife, Ronda Armitage), New Zealand Library Association, 1978, for The Lighthouse Keeper's Lunch.
